Who are we?

Oxa is enabling the transition to self-driving vehicles through an initial focus on the most commercially advanced sector; the autonomous shuttling of goods and people.

We are home to some of the world’s leading experts on autonomous vehicles, creating solutions such as Oxa Driver, equipping vehicles with full self-driving functionality; Oxa MetaDriver, using Generative AI to accelerate and assure the safety of deployments; and Oxa Hub, a set of cloud-based offerings for autonomous fleet management. Our technology is being deployed across the UK and the U.S, and we’re partnering with a fast-growing ecosystem of operators, vehicle OEMs and equipment makers serving autonomous transportation globally as it advances.

Based in Oxford, and with offices in Canada and the U.S, Oxa was founded in 2014 and is growing rapidly (350 ‘Oxbots’ to date). Our purpose is to change the way the Earth moves, through an uncompromising focus on safety, efficiency and explainability of our AI approaches. The company has attracted $225 million from leading investors so far, with $140 million raised in the last Series C funding round in January 2023.

Your Team

The Solutions Team is a rapidly growing team at Oxa. It owns the whole customer lifecycle, and is charged with leveraging Oxa's world class expertise to deliver real world, commercially viable autonomous solutions that provide genuine, demonstrable value to customers. As such, the team is a unique blend of technical and commercial problem solvers that have experience in deploying robotic systems in the field and solving problems with autonomy. Members of the team have the opportunity to try on many hats - both technically across the autonomy stack and spanning from writing code to whiteboarding with customers to find the best solution.

The Solutions Team specifies (and may develop) tools required for delivering successful solutions. The team strives to understand all parts of the system to a level in which they can present and explain each of those components/modules of technology to a customer and how it contributed to the overall solution. Members of the Solutions Team are a dynamic and engaged group of people from diverse cultural and professional backgrounds, all working together towards our goal of Universal Autonomy with an obsessive customer focus.

Your Role

  • Generate technical roadmaps and deliver end-to-end solutions for our diverse customers.
  • Create and maintain documentation for the architecture of software systems, APIs, and decision flows.
  • Design and implement solutions.
  • Build, upgrade, and maintain maps for customer testing and deployments.
  • Coordinate and ensure timely delivery through alignment meetings with the team.
  • Identify and address performance-related issues that hinder system deployment.
  • Maintain a dashboard and generate regular reports on team-owned KPIs.
  • Collaborate with team members, suggest high-level approaches, and participate in code reviews and pair programming.
  • Contribute to sprint cycles, including planning, reviewing, and managing risks or scope creep.

Requirements

What you need to succeed:

  • Bachelor’s / MASc degree or equivalent experience in computer science or robotics
  • > 1 years experience in writing C software
  • Demonstrated experience in development / delivery of robotics system and participation in product in a commercial or industrial setting
  • Demonstrated experience in HW/SW interfacing and integration

Extra kudos if you have:

  • Python: experience using tools to create
  • Robotics and hardware
  • Platform hardware and configuration
  • The ability to translate customer concepts and requirements to a technical solution or service.
  • Able to discuss a program equally well with the customer as with engineers.
